// Local service business

VC Flooring & Stone — Honolulu

A renovation contractor doing flooring, custom cabinets and quartz countertops across Oahu. Local service businesses live or die on service-area searches — 'quartz countertop installers Honolulu' — which are exactly the queries nobody has time to write pages for.

Worth knowing before you weigh this: the owner is a friend of ours, so it isn't an arm's-length customer win. The articles and the dates are still real, and you can read them. This blog also runs on our subdomain rather than their own domain — that's the default setup, and it means the search value accrues to seolyn.io rather than to them. Pointing it at your own domain is a DNS record you can add whenever you want; they haven't, and it still works.

// Shopify store

PurrPour — our own cat-supply store

A Shopify store selling a cordless cat water dispenser. Articles are written in Seolyn and pushed into the store's own blog through the Shopify API, so the posts live on the merchant's domain next to their products rather than on a separate site.
